Cassandra Joseph has joined Cypress Development’s Board of Directors.

Ms. Joseph is an attorney with more than 20 years of experience working in natural resources, environmental and corporate law. She is Senior Vice President, General Counsel and Corporate Secretary for Nevada Copper Corp., and Director and Chair of the Governance and Nomination Committee of Bunker Hill Mining Corp.

A resident of Nevada, Ms. Joseph was Associate General Counsel for Tahoe Resources Inc. and worked for the Attorney Generals of California and Nevada. She was a partner in Watson Rounds PLC (now Brownstein Hyatt Farber Schreck LLP) where she litigated intellectual property cases.

She holds a J.D. from Santa Clara University School of Law and a B.A. from U.C. Berkeley.

“We are pleased to welcome Cassandra to the Cypress Board of Directors,” said Cypress CEO Bill Willoughby.

“We look forward to her many contributions as we move our Clayton Valley Lithium Project in Nevada towards a feasibility study and permitting.”

Cypress Development Corp is a Canadian exploration company focused on developing its 100%-owned Clayton Valley Lithium Project in Nevada.
